A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 10.08.2005, 10:53   #1  
DreamCreator is offline
DreamCreator
Moderator
Аватар для DreamCreator
Axapta Retail User
 
553 / 45 (3) +++
Регистрация: 04.11.2004
Адрес: Казань
Добавление аналитики
День добрый!

Необходимо добавить в заголовок заказа поле 'ячейка'. Думаю что правильно (и красиво) в этом случае добавить в SalesTable ссылку на InventDim, с другой стороны на sys-вском слое в SalesTable уже добавлен склад InventLocationId (нет никакой ссылки на InventDim). Очевидно что можно просто добавить новое поле wMSLocationId в SalesTable.

Интересно Ваше мнение -- как поступаете в случае добавления аналитик, ведь ситуация довольно распространена.
Старый 10.08.2005, 12:00   #2  
macklakov is offline
macklakov
NavAx
Аватар для macklakov
 
2,232 / 974 (37) +++++++
Регистрация: 03.04.2002
Вариант с InventDim, более универсальный, хотя и несколько более сложный. Если доработка разовая, то можно, по быстрому, обойтись и одним полем. Но, может случиться, что пользователи со временем войдут во вкус и захотят автоматической подстановки других аналитик.
__________________
Isn't it nice when things just work?
Старый 03.05.2006, 12:20   #3  
kvg6 is offline
kvg6
program-ёр
Аватар для kvg6
1C
 
160 / 81 (3) ++++
Регистрация: 27.09.2005
Адрес: Moscow forever
Добрый день!
А, вообще, возможно-ли (и приветствуется-ли) добавление новой складской аналитики?
Пожалуйста, поделитесь опытом.
__________________
Становись лучше
Старый 03.05.2006, 13:11   #4  
macklakov is offline
macklakov
NavAx
Аватар для macklakov
 
2,232 / 974 (37) +++++++
Регистрация: 03.04.2002
Цитата:
Сообщение от kvg6
А, вообще, возможно-ли (и приветствуется-ли) добавление новой складской аналитики?
Если нужно, можно добавить. Но стоит помнить, что от новых аналитик, inventTrans начинает быстрее расти, что отрицательно сказывается на быстродействии системы
__________________
Isn't it nice when things just work?
Старый 03.05.2006, 13:14   #5  
Def is offline
Def
Участник
 
50 / 32 (2) +++
Регистрация: 28.09.2005
уважаемый почему InventTrans
InventDim наверное
Старый 03.05.2006, 13:27   #6  
macklakov is offline
macklakov
NavAx
Аватар для macklakov
 
2,232 / 974 (37) +++++++
Регистрация: 03.04.2002
Цитата:
Сообщение от Def
уважаемый почему InventTrans
InventDim наверное
InventDim, сама по себе, на быстродействие почти не влияет. Но добавление новых аналитик, в общем случае, ведет к большему колличеству проводок по каждой хозяйственной операции, т.к. деление склада становится более детальным. А это, в свою очередь, ведет к большему количеству записей в InventTrans. А InventTrans, таблица "горячая"
__________________
Isn't it nice when things just work?
Старый 03.05.2006, 13:36   #7  
kvg6 is offline
kvg6
program-ёр
Аватар для kvg6
1C
 
160 / 81 (3) ++++
Регистрация: 27.09.2005
Адрес: Moscow forever
Цитата:
Сообщение от macklakov
Если нужно, можно добавить
Хотим добавить аналитику "Состояние номенклатуры", но боимся завалить Ах
__________________
Становись лучше
Старый 03.05.2006, 13:49   #8  
macklakov is offline
macklakov
NavAx
Аватар для macklakov
 
2,232 / 974 (37) +++++++
Регистрация: 03.04.2002
Цитата:
Сообщение от kvg6
Хотим добавить аналитику "Состояние номенклатуры", но боимся завалить Ах
Не бойтесь, уроните обязательно! Но это ведь так увлекательно!
А если играться некогда, то обратитесь к своим внедренцам. Такую модификацию каждый второй делал, даже мастер написали: Модуль "Developer+"
__________________
Isn't it nice when things just work?
Старый 03.05.2006, 13:59   #9  
mazzy is offline
mazzy
Участник
Аватар для mazzy
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
Лучший по профессии 2009
 
29,472 / 4494 (208) ++++++++++
Регистрация: 29.11.2001
Адрес: Москва
Записей в блоге: 10
Цитата:
Сообщение от macklakov
InventDim, сама по себе, на быстродействие почти не влияет.
Давайте сформулируем точнее.
Аксапта строит запросы исходя из принципа, что inventDim на порядки меньше, чем InventTrans.
В этом случае производительность будет нормальной.

Производительность будет отвратительной, если
1. размер InventDim сравним с размером InventTrans (или больше)
2. и размер этих двух таблиц достаточно большой (обе таблицы не помещаются в кэш СУБД полностью)
__________________
полезное на axForum, github, vk, coub.
Старый 03.05.2006, 14:06   #10  
Андре is offline
Андре
Moderator
Сотрудники компании GMCS
 
2,375 / 464 (20) +++++++
Регистрация: 03.12.2001
Цитата:
Сообщение от macklakov
InventDim, сама по себе, на быстродействие почти не влияет.
Влияет ее join на InventTrans.
Старый 03.05.2006, 14:50   #11  
glibs is offline
glibs
Member
Сотрудники компании It Box
Most Valuable Professional
Лучший по профессии 2011
Лучший по профессии 2009
 
4,942 / 911 (40) +++++++
Регистрация: 10.06.2002
Адрес: I am from Kyiv, Ukraine. Now I am in Moscow. For private contacts: glibs@hotmail.com
Цитата:
Сообщение от macklakov
...
InventDim, сама по себе, на быстродействие почти не влияет.
...
Я пока сам не видел, но слышал, что еще как влияет, если за несколько лет ее раздувать хотябы партиями и ГТД (а еще могут быть ячейки и паллеты).

А потом запросы по проводкам начинают тормозить. Особенно критично при сводном планировании.

Кстати, табличка ничего себе. Килобайт на запись (вместе с индексами). Можно себе представить, как ее может разнести при большом количестве аналитик, и как потом запросы будут обрабатываться.

Так что не стоит так категорично.
__________________
С уважением,
glibs®
Старый 03.05.2006, 15:16   #12  
macklakov is offline
macklakov
NavAx
Аватар для macklakov
 
2,232 / 974 (37) +++++++
Регистрация: 03.04.2002
Цитата:
Сообщение от glibs
Я пока сам не видел, но слышал, что еще как влияет, если за несколько лет ее раздувать хотябы партиями и ГТД (а еще могут быть ячейки и паллеты).
Я даже не слышал, но признаю, это возможно
__________________
Isn't it nice when things just work?
Старый 24.05.2006, 17:39   #13  
kvg6 is offline
kvg6
program-ёр
Аватар для kvg6
1C
 
160 / 81 (3) ++++
Регистрация: 27.09.2005
Адрес: Moscow forever
Аналитика добавлена успешно.
В качестве образца взята аналитика InventGtdId_RU. (Т.е. поиск ее по АОТ и добавление новой по аналогии).
__________________
Становись лучше
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Добавление новой складской аналитики, axapta 4. Hub DAX: Программирование 25 13.10.2015 12:30
Добавление финансовой аналитики AxaptaUser DAX: Программирование 2 20.03.2007 14:26
Автоматическое добавление аналитики в ГК. NJD DAX: Программирование 6 11.10.2004 16:07
Добавление фин аналитики.Вопросы. NJD DAX: Программирование 3 13.09.2004 13:54
Добавление лицензионной аналитики Natashka DAX: Администрирование 7 03.03.2003 12:44
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 02:06.